The Katharine House Hospice Cup organsied by Mayday Employment & hosted by APFC raised a whopping £1453! An amazing effort by all involved.

The Katharine House Hospice Cup held on 4th August, where a Mayday XI took on a DCS XI all in aid of the local charity raised a fantastic £1453.

The match was hosted at Adderbury Park Football Club with the team also supplying a large number of players to support the event and the club donating to the sponsorship and raffle. The club currently have the Katharine House Hospice logo on all their shirts and Mayday Employment are the official 1st Team sponsor, so it was a great event for the club to be involved in.

The Mayday XI ran out 5-4 winners on the day. A huge thank you to all the players involved on the day and for donating their time and money to such a great cause.

A huge well done to former APFC player Christian Seeney for organising the event. It will return again next summer with a new format, so watch this space!
